Moonstone Landing is a family-owned oceanfront Hotel located on Moonstone Beach Drive in the resort village of Cambria. We are a pet-free and smoke-free property. All rooms have either a full ocean view or partial ocean view with a fireplace in every room. Relax in a jacuzzi tub in the full ocean view rooms. Every room has free internet access, flat screen TV, refrigerator, microwave, and coffeemaker. A free continental breakfast is included with your stay.

Before posting, each Tripadvisor review goes through an automated tracking system, which collects information, answering the following questions: how, what, where and when. If the system detects something that potentially contradicts our community guidelines, the review is not published.
When the system detects a problem, a review may be automatically rejected, sent to the reviewer for validation, or manually reviewed by our team of content specialists, who work 24/7 to maintain the quality of the reviews on our site.
Our team checks each review posted on the site disputed by our community as not meeting our community guidelines.

This was our second time saying here. our first time staying was about eight years ago, and we had a lovely room on the upper floor facing the ocean. We decided that we were eager to go back for my husband’s 45th birthday celebration. The upper floor was not available so we booked a lower floor ocean view room. The room was beautiful. The bed was comfy and the fireplace added a beautiful ambience to the room. The patio had a nice seating area for us to enjoy breakfast while watching the waves. Speaking of breakfast, the pastries provided from Lynn’s diner were amazing. The only issue we had with the room was there was a horrible smell coming from the shower after it had been ran. The first night we did not shower until late in the evening , and figured maybe the room had not been used in a while so the pipes just needed to be flushed out. However, returning to the room the next evening and showering, we noticed the smell was still there after the water had been run. The smell was that of sewer and started to fill the rest of the room with the stench. It was too late in the evening to call and complain so we just shut the door to the bathroom and open the sliding patio door to air it out. We did report it to the girl at the front desk upon check out the next day. She did advise us that she would send the complaint up to management . Hopefully the smell has been fixed for people staying there going forward. .

A very average inn on Moonstone beach. Definitely hyped up online and didn’t live up to all the great reviews. Maybe our experience was a one-off but we won’t be back. Pros: -The view. We booked an ocean front room with 2 queens, and the view is spectacular. -Bedding and linens were nice. Reminded me of Westin bedding. Very cozy. -Bed was comfortable -Spacious room for this size inn -Fireplace seemed nice, didn’t use it. Cons: -ANTS. During check-in, the front desk staff told me they have ants due to the ongoing drought. I even initialed on a waiver stating I won’t leave food in my room. Well they were all over the bathroom. Spent 10 mins wiping them up after we got into our room. -Waiver—had to sign my life away (maybe, didn’t read it fully) while checking in. I know I had to sign something saying I’ll be quiet after 10pm, acknowledge the ants, and promise not to ruin their new flooring. Weird. -Noise. Being on the first floor was loud. We could hear our upstairs neighbors walking around. -TV. The remote is almost laughable as it looks like a toy. And was not user friendly. Almost called the front desk to ask how to use it. That was a first.

Will be leaving in the morning after having spent five nights in Room 101. Housekeeping was excellent. Pillows suck; we should have brought our own. My neck is killing me. This is a motel, meaning room doors open to the outside. Watching some of the people who walked into the parking lot, I wished our door had a swing bar on it -- a suggestion I made in my last review. The rooms also need a lighted makeup mirror and a safe. Having stayed here a couple of times, we knew we'd find one luggage rack. With two suitcases, we decided to bring our luggage rack from home with us. What a pleasant surprise to find that there were two luggage racks in our closet! They have upgraded their breakfast option. I noticed that, instead of pre-packaged store-bought muffins, they now have a selection of muffins from Linn's Restaurant & Bakery. That's definitely an improvement. The room needs maintenance: touch up paint is needed through-out and there are big cracks in the bathroom floor. Mary, about whom I've raved in past reviews, has passed; therefore, I didn't get the warm welcome that I've come to expect from Mary. But, that's life: no one gets out alive.
